Output 6b80b393831ea986a7629ab807f5e8855c74ba95195a4037011634aef6a0aa33:1

value
41770536
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d9769c983e450f18e3a424f0b5bdad6a36f08816 OP_EQUALVERIFY OP_CHECKSIG
address
1LpqiuvX4RAkWWMfMX6MS4DWx45RvVd6Ap
transaction
6b80b393831ea986a7629ab807f5e8855c74ba95195a4037011634aef6a0aa33
spent
true